If you are still wondering if you need a Dubai visa if you are an Indian living in Qatar then it is highly possible that you will have to apply for a Dubai visa … Web6 apr. 2024 · Indians dominate professions like doctors and teachers in Qatar hospitals, universities, and schools. Many Indians also work as carpenters, plumbers, and construction workers. Most of the Indians come from Kerala but now Uttar Pradesh has taken the place according to the statistics given by the Ministry of Overseas Indian Affairs.
